当前位置: 首页 > news >正文

GPIO _OUTPUT-NORMAL 模式

打开 Simulink 的模型配置界面,首先配置 Solver 选项卡,设置 Stop Time 为 inf Slover options 为定步长离散解算器,也就是选择 Fixed-Step ,并选择 discrete。定步长设置为 0.5 秒。在 Diagonostics 选项卡中的 Data Validity 选项中,将 Multitask data store 配 置为 none
!!!编译之后报错
错误:计算在模块图 'untitled1' 的 "配置参数" 对话框中指定的 'FixedStep' 的表达式 '0.5s' 时出错。
原因:
    无效表达式。请检查缺失的乘法运算符、缺失或不对称的分隔符或者其他语法错误。要构造矩阵,请使用方括号而不是圆括号。
注意 定步长设置为 0.5 秒,不能带s,只需输入数字0.5
Diagonostics 选项卡中的 Data Validity 选项中,将 Multitask data store 配 置为 none

Hardware Implementation 中 选 择 Hardware board TI Defino F2833x(boot from flash),这时 simulink 会自动选定 TI c2000 系列。然后配置该 界面下 build action build Device name F28335 。并勾选 Use custom linker command。然后在 Clocking 选项中,外部晶振为 30M ,将系统时钟配置为 150MHz,高速外设时钟 2 分频,低速时钟外设 4 分频。其他外设模块按自己需
要配置。
Code generation 选项卡中使用的 Toolchain CCSv6 。在 Code generation objectives 的 Prioritized objectives 中将执行效率、 ROM 效率、 RAM 效率设置为 优先的代码生成目标。在 report 中勾选 Generate model web view 使生成的代码 可以进行模型与代码之间相互的跟踪。在 Code Placement 中配置 Code Packaging 为 Modular
这是生成ccs工程必须选择的前提,注意配置好路径
编译成功之后弹出代码生成报告,复制路径在ccs软件打开
以下是CCS文件的配置
导入matlab生成的文件路径
打开工程后右键,如图所示点击Target Configuration File
如果忘记修改而直接退出,可以按图所示方法重新配置
按如图所示save好配置
点击锤子进行编译,编译成功后可连接开发板进行烧录

相关文章:

  • Ubuntu和Debian 操作系统的同与异
  • Vue 高级技巧深度解析
  • 【星闪模组开发板WS8204SLEBLEModule】星闪数据收发测试
  • 信息系统项目管理师-工具名词解释(下)
  • STM32 TDS+温度补偿
  • MySQL——存储
  • Redis 分布式锁+秒杀异步优化
  • android11 DevicePolicyManager浅析
  • Rocky8.10安装openhalo1.0
  • 算法——通俗讲解升幂定理
  • 基于深度学习的狗鼻纹身份识别
  • 定制开发还是源码搭建?如何快速上线同城外卖跑腿APP?
  • 算法堆排序记录
  • 1022 Digital Library
  • 【ROS2】行为树 BehaviorTree(五):详细学习端口和黑板
  • 项目集管理汇报报告 (范本)
  • 什么时候触发full GC(发生场景)
  • Snipaste免费版安装教程包含下载、安装、使用(附安装包)
  • Tmi-clnet:从影像学、临床和放射学数据融合判断慢性肝病预后的三模态相互作用网络——医学图像论文学习,论文源码下载
  • 远程登录一个Linux系统,如何用命令快速知道该系统属于Linux的哪个发行版,以及该服务器的各种配置参数,运行状态?
  • 伊朗港口爆炸事故遇难人数最终确定为57人
  • 局势紧张之际,伊朗外长下周访问巴基斯坦和印度
  • 5月1日,多位省级党委书记调研旅游市场、假期安全等情况
  • 5月1日全国铁路发送旅客2311.9万人次,创历史新高
  • 拍摄《我们这一代》的肖全开展“江浙沪叙事”
  • 网商银行2024年年报发布,客户资产管理规模超过1万亿